Skip to main content

ScalaCCF - utility to fix style and documentation comments in Scala files

Project description

Metaprogramming. Scala style and documentation fixer

Requirements

Python: 3.4

Install PyPI package

pip install scalaccf

Help

usage: ScalaCCF.py [-h] [-p P] [-d D] [-f F] [-v] [-t]

ScalaCCF - utility to fix style and documentation comments in Scala files

optional arguments:
  -h, --help    show this help message and exit
  -p P          Path to scala project directory to fix.
  -d D          Path to directory with Scala files to fix.
  -f F          Path to Scala file to fix.
  -v, --verify  Verify style and documentation comments
  -t, --trace   Fix style and documentation comments

Examples

python ScalaCCF.py -f 'C:\Users\Me\Scala\MyClass.scala' --trace
python ScalaCCF.py -p 'C:\Users\Me\Projects\MyProject' --trace

Using installed PyPI package:

scalaccf -f 'C:\Users\Me\Scala\MyClass.scala' --trace

Other

If namings in path of package or file have incorrect naming utility creates new package or file with correct namings.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

scalaccf-0.1.26.tar.gz (9.9 kB view details)

Uploaded Source

File details

Details for the file scalaccf-0.1.26.tar.gz.

File metadata

  • Download URL: scalaccf-0.1.26.tar.gz
  • Upload date:
  • Size: 9.9 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.2.0 pkginfo/1.6.1 requests/2.25.0 setuptools/49.6.0 requests-toolbelt/0.9.1 tqdm/4.54.0 CPython/3.6.8

File hashes

Hashes for scalaccf-0.1.26.tar.gz
Algorithm Hash digest
SHA256 86e8f558d8e1f87c888ef2bac6a23a5fb57c635a1c173a19997f9bcc65096c5c
MD5 03e22d88e4f575e444da10e054d6ca14
BLAKE2b-256 0394b1e82dfafe7ff8f508d63a5bd815bbb7bfcd278411fc510b3886cb835b7e

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page